When to Capitalize North, South, East and West - Proofed

WebSep 18, 2024 · You should capitalize “North,” “South,” “East,” and “West” when they’re part of a proper noun (i.e., the name of a unique thing). The obvious examples of this are countries, states, cities, and other geographical areas: We study the history of Eastern Europe. I’m visiting South Africa next year. WebAt the most basic level, the standard advice is to lowercase north, south, east and west when used as compass directions and to capitalize them when they are used as part of a proper noun or adjective or refer to regions or geographic areas. When ‘north’, ‘south’, ‘east’ and ‘west’ refer to generic directions (i.e. the points of the compass), they are not capitalised:. Scotland is to the north of England.. We walked south for three miles.. The sun always sets in the west.. The master bedroom is in the east wing of the mansion..
